SOV./124-58-11-12112 Translation from: Referativnyy zhurnal, Mekhanika, 1958, Nr 11, p 2 1 (USSR) AUTHOR: Bogdanov, P.M. TITLE:~__ -Onthe-F--re-e -Bounc-i-n-g''O'scillations of Railroad Cars Mounted on Double -suspension Railway Trucks --- With Allowance Made for the Friction Forces (0 sobstvennykh kolebaniyakh podprygivaniya vagonov na telezhkakh dvoynogo podveshivaniya s uchetom sil treniya) PERIODICAL: Tr. Bryanskogo in-ta transp. mashinostr. , 1957, Nr 17, pp 177-184 ABSTRACT: The author examines the nature of the damping of the free bouncing oscillations of a railroad car that has a double suspension and is char- acterized by the presence of friction in its central or box suspension; examined also is the relationship between the period of these oscilla- tions and their amplitude. The author concludes that: 1) The damping of the oscillations does not follow the law of arithmetical progression, as is true in the case of a single suspension with only a single source of friction; 2) the oscillation period is a function of the oscillatory amplitude and of the force of friction---iis a result of which the pheno- menon of resonance does not occur. So long as the oscillatory ampli- ~Gatrd 1/2 tudes are small, it is only the box springs that oscillate; the central SOV/124-58-1 I-AZ I I Z On the Free Bouncing Oscillations of Railraod Cars (cont. ) suspension will not then be functioning. In this connection the author recommends the use of shock absorbers which have no f!-iction band and in which the friction forces increase with increasing oscillatory amplitudes. L M. Ionnyye kXis-1 ta14 (Ionic crystals), 13-21 TOPIC TAGS: radiation chemistry, photochemistry, potassium chloride, proton bombard-1 ment, phosphorus compound, radioactive decay ABSTRACT: The purpose of the investigation vas to determine the infl-uence of radia- tion and photochemical effects on the chemical state of atoms of radioactive phos- phorus in potassium chloride. The KC1 crystals (pure and with CaCl2 admixture) used as targets for proton irradiation were grown by the Kiropoulos method. 7he crystals i were placed in light tight boxes and exposed to an external beam of protons of 660- Mev enekgy with a maximum total proton flux 2 x 1012/cm2. The crystals were also exposed to light in the F band (560 run) for different durations, after vhich the dis-'!; thr tribution of the activity of the radioactive phosphor was determined for the _;W ee produced fractions (phosphate, phosphite, and hypophospbite) by a procedure described in an earlier paper (Izv. AN SSSR, v. 8, 1433, 1961). The results shou that 411umina- V2 ACC NRI AT7001779 tion of the crystal decreases the yield of the phosphate and phosphite radioactive phosphorus., and increases the yield of the hypophosphite fraction. After about three houri; of illumination, the concentrations of the activity of the phosphorus by fractions change from 35.5) 20, and 44-5% for H3PO4) H3PO3, and H3PO2, to 20, 10, 1 and 70% respectively. In the mixed crystals the redistribution of the activity oc- curred at a lower speed, and no plateau was reached even after ten hours. Total bleaching of the crystals, by exposure to 560-nm light for severalldays together with. a tungsten lamp, showed that after 8 or 10 days the processes reverse, and the activi~ ty of the hypophosphite decreases whereas that of the phosphite and phosphate in- creases. The effect of proton irradiation on the chemical state of the radioactive phosphorus was also studied and it was found that proton irradiation first oxidizes e radioactive phosphorus intensely, after which the rate of oxidation decreases t h and reduction of the radioactive phosphate sets in. Possible causes of all the ef- fects are indicated. The authors'thank G. D. Z.; Kibyakov, A. V. .00 - Title On the mechanism of stomach innervation in birds Periodical : Fiziol. zhur. 2, 239-242, Mar-Apr 1955- FD-246o Abstract : In cockerels and chicken under pentothal anesthesia, partial removal of the pancreas and ligature of its ductus decreases the inotropic effect and the tonic contraction of the stomach produced by vagus stimulation, vhile the chronotropic effect of vagus stimulation is not changed except for an increase in the latent period. It is as- sumed that the effect of pancreas removal is mediated by interfer- ence vith acetylcholine synthesis. Graphs. Five references, 4 of them USSR (all since 1940). V.1.Chichikovp G. Stetsenko, V. V.; Vitkevich; V. B. ORG: none A TITLE: Hydraulic amp ifie for a steering mechanism of a machine on wheels. Class 63, No. 180965 SOURCE: Izobreteniya, promyshlennyye obraztsy, tovarnyye 7-nald, no. 8, 1966, 134 1 TOPIC TAGS: hydraulic device, hydraulic equipment, hydraulic pressure amplifier, ABSMACT: This Author Certificate presents a hydraulic amplifier for a steering mechanism of a machine on wheels. The amplifier is built into the steering mechanism and is connected to the steering shaft. It contains a lead element in the form of a screw, a power cylinder (with its shaft connected to a spline attached to a sector of the steering mechanism), and a distributor. The latter consists of a casing fixed on the gear box of the steering mechonism. The casing contains ducts leading to the working interior of the power cylinder and to its pressure and outflow pipes. A cylindrical Placed in the casing is located on the ateering shaft, while two stops limit the axial displacement of the steering shaft. To provide for the indica- tion of gauge readin f the automatic steering augmented by hand steering. a distributing sleeve fwlh slides in respect to the cylindrical valve and to the Card I LC42 67-67 ACC NRt AP6013315 casing) is placed in the body of the distributor concentrically with the -Valve. The sleeve contains openingv for passing of liquid and in motivated by plungers placed in the casing and connected to the gauge of automatic steering. These plungers interact with the face surfaces of washers contacting the sleeve. The washers serve as sup- ports limiting the displacement of the sleeve in the casing (see Fig. 1). Fig. 1. 1 - steering shaft; 2 - screw; 3 - power cylinder; 4 - GWt of +Ale power cylinder; 5 - spline; 6 sector of the steering mechanism; 7 distributor body; 8 - valves; 9 - pressure duct; 10 - overflow duct; 11 - cylindrical valve; 12 - automatic steering gauge; 13 - slid- ing sleeve; 14 - plungers The working displacement of the sleeve (limited by the washers) ii, smaller than the working displacement of the valvn. V. PWrakova. J. Ap=02TWi. -1JGxSB1Vj;W1 40(IONXISn9l. trawlation).-Typical pWM&phk sit- veloper forroulas have been exanul. and their buffer capacity retarded.. At high J&vsiopmeat rates, the alkali in the dc, vtlop~r "em 14 unable to iliffust rapidly enough Into I he' emulomtontaintaintbemiginalimalpil. Thereforr.bur- ter actkm Is ncmwy It local alkalinity Is to be kept at the de*W kvtl. Developer activity is thereby tuaintained at hi her level. Unbuffered developers yW a higher film tivity than buffered developers If de"loped to the same = contrast level. Leveling action of a developer 1% nvare pro- nounced at Ia. a buffer capacities. R. J.
